This is a great series and long overdue for collections. Probably the definitive modern Shazam book (after the golden age stuff). The only thing holding it back is DC’s constant event tie-ins from the 90s. There were two different events during this series’ first 12 issues that pulled Captain Marvel out of his own series, forcing the reader to play catch up and fill in gaps in the story. Oh, how good it is to revisit these stories by Jerry Ordway, Peter Krause, Mike Manley, and the rest! This is my second favorite Shazam! era, after the late '70s/early '80s run that started in SHAZAM! #34-35, continued in WORLD'S FINEST COMICS, and concluded in ADVENTURE COMICS (digest) #492. So happy to see DC finally collecting the wonderful POWER OF SHAZAM! series.
